UnicodeChr

 

指定された文字コードをUnicode文字に変換

指定された数値を文字コード(10進)とするUnicode文字に変換します。

構文:

UnicodeChr(数値)

パラメータ:

  • 数値 …… Unicodeの文字コードを表す数値 (0 ~ 65,535)

戻り値:

Unicode文字 …… 指定された文字コードに基づくUnicode文字

文字コードが、0 ~ 65,535の範囲以外の場合、NULLが返ります。

例:

UnicodeChr(12355)

 

10進数の「12355」は、「x'3043'」、これはUnicodeの「い」として返ります。

注意:

この関数では10進数で数値を指定する必要がありますが、通常Unicodeのコードページは16進数で表されています。Hval()関数を使用することで10進数に変換することができます。

関連トピック:

UnicodeVal